Muscat – The Oman Aquatics Federation has appointed Algerian coach Mohamed Bouguerra as general coach of the national swimming teams as it steps up preparations for upcoming regional and international competitions.
Bouguerra brings extensive coaching experience, including a stint in charge of the Algerian national team, and specialises in the physical and technical development of competitive swimmers.
The federation said the appointment forms part of its strategy to strengthen the national technical set-up and provide Omani swimmers with a more integrated preparation programme.
Bouguerra said he was pleased to take up the role in Oman and would focus on transferring his experience and introducing training programmes aimed at improving the performance of male and female swimmers.
He also stressed the importance of building a strong base capable of producing competitive results in future championships.
The federation said the move is intended to improve the readiness of national team swimmers and raise their technical standards as Oman looks to strengthen its presence in regional and international aquatics competitions.
